I recently upgraded my a5 with a r.t. and i have had trouble with balls breaking after 3-4 shoots. It doesnt matter how fast i have the r.t. set it still does the same thing. The only other mods i have done in compressed air, a new front bolt star style. The problem still was there before any mods. It never broke a ball trying to shoot before the R.T. I tried replacing the ball detent and it didn't if anyone has any ideas please help. Thanks |

It sounds like to me that maybe your gun never had the experience of shooting as fast before the R/T. I have heard a lot of problems with the star bolt busting balls. There are a few things to try first 1. Remove Star bolt, and try again 2. Try a new batch of paintballs (the ones your shooting may be no good. 3. Check and make sure you cyclone feed is clean and does not have any sharp edges on it. |
